What is a LOLER Thorough Examination?

A LOLER Thorough Examination is a systematic and detailed examination of lifting equipment and its safety-critical components.

It must be carried out by a competent person with the appropriate practical and theoretical knowledge and experience of the equipment being examined.

The purpose is to identify defects or weaknesses that could affect the safe continued use of the equipment.

It is important to understand that a LOLER Thorough Examination is not the same as routine maintenance or servicing. Equipment still needs to be properly maintained between examinations.


What Does a LOLER Failure Mean?

There isn't simply a "pass or fail" sticker for every LOLER examination.

A Thorough Examination may identify defects that require action within a specified period, while serious defects that are or could become a danger to people may require the equipment to be taken out of service immediately.

The competent person records significant defects in the examination report and advises the dutyholder on the action required.

That's why regular maintenance, pre-use checks and timely LOLER examinations are so important.


1. Worn or Damaged Lifting Chains

Lifting chains are exposed to significant loads and repeated use, making wear and damage an important area for inspection.

An inspector may look for:

  • Excessive wear

  • Elongation

  • Corrosion

  • Cracked or damaged links

  • Distortion

  • Heat damage

  • Evidence of inappropriate use

A damaged chain can compromise the safety of an entire lifting operation.

How to reduce the risk

Operators should carry out appropriate pre-use checks and report damaged chains immediately.

Chains should also be stored correctly and maintained in accordance with the manufacturer's recommendations.


2. Damaged Webbing Slings

Webbing slings are widely used across construction, manufacturing, engineering, warehousing and many other industries.

Because they are flexible and lightweight, they can also be susceptible to damage.

Common problems include:

  • Cuts

  • Tears

  • Fraying

  • Broken stitching

  • Abrasion

  • Heat damage

  • Chemical damage

  • Missing or illegible identification labels

A sling that has suffered significant damage should not simply be put back into service.

How to reduce the risk

Store slings away from damaging conditions and carry out suitable checks before use.

Never use a lifting accessory if you are unsure whether it remains safe.


3. Damaged or Distorted Hooks

Hooks are critical load-bearing components of lifting equipment.

During a LOLER Thorough Examination, an inspector may identify:

  • Cracks

  • Excessive wear

  • Distortion

  • Damaged safety catches

  • Corrosion

  • Incorrect hook opening

  • Other signs of deterioration

A damaged hook can present a serious risk because it may affect the secure attachment of the load.

How to reduce the risk

Never exceed the equipment's rated capacity and report damaged or distorted hooks immediately.


4. Excessive Corrosion

Corrosion can gradually weaken lifting equipment, particularly where equipment is used outdoors or in wet, humid, chemical or otherwise harsh environments.

Corrosion may affect:

  • Chains

  • Hooks

  • Beams

  • Frames

  • Wire ropes

  • Fixings

  • Structural components

The important issue isn't simply whether rust is present — it is whether deterioration could affect the safe operation or structural integrity of the equipment.

How to reduce the risk

Regularly clean and maintain equipment and pay particular attention to equipment operating in harsh environments.


5. Structural Damage, Cracks or Deformation

Structural integrity is a major consideration during a Thorough Examination.

Inspectors may identify:

  • Cracked welds

  • Bent components

  • Deformation

  • Damaged lifting points

  • Structural corrosion

  • Damaged frames or supports

These defects can potentially affect the equipment's ability to safely support its intended load.

How to reduce the risk

Any suspected structural damage should be reported immediately and the equipment assessed by an appropriately competent person.

Do not attempt to hide or ignore damage simply because the equipment still appears to operate normally.


6. Faulty Safety Devices

Modern lifting equipment can incorporate a range of safety devices designed to prevent dangerous situations.

Depending on the equipment, these may include:

  • Limit switches

  • Overload protection

  • Safety catches

  • Interlocks

  • Braking systems

  • Emergency stop systems

A defect affecting a safety-critical device can significantly increase the risk associated with using the equipment.

How to reduce the risk

Safety devices should be maintained and tested as appropriate for the equipment.

Any suspected fault should be investigated before the equipment continues to be used.


7. Missing or Illegible SWL Markings

Safe Working Load (SWL) information is extremely important.

Operators need to know the capacity of lifting equipment so that loads can be planned and carried out safely.

HSE guidance states that lifting equipment should be suitably marked with information such as its safe working load where appropriate.

Problems can arise when:

  • Identification plates are missing

  • SWL markings are damaged

  • Labels are illegible

  • Equipment configuration changes its lifting capacity

  • Operators cannot clearly determine the safe capacity

How to reduce the risk

Regularly check identification plates, markings and labels.

If information is missing or unclear, seek competent advice before using the equipment.


8. Poor Maintenance and Unresolved Defects

A LOLER Thorough Examination is not a replacement for routine maintenance.

Lifting equipment should be maintained so that it remains safe to use.

Common maintenance-related problems can include:

  • Worn components

  • Loose fixings

  • Damaged hydraulic hoses

  • Oil leaks

  • Deteriorated electrical components

  • Missing parts

  • Previously identified defects that have not been repaired

HSE guidance makes clear that thorough examination and routine maintenance are separate responsibilities.

How to reduce the risk

Don't wait for your next LOLER examination to deal with obvious defects.

Implement a planned maintenance programme and keep appropriate records of repairs and maintenance.


9. Incomplete or Missing LOLER Records

The physical condition of lifting equipment isn't the only consideration.

Businesses also need to keep appropriate records of Thorough Examinations.

A LOLER Thorough Examination report should contain specific information, including the examination date, the date when the next examination is due, and details of defects that are or could become a danger to people.

Poor record keeping can make it difficult to demonstrate that your inspection programme is being properly managed.

How to reduce the risk

Keep your LOLER reports organised and make sure you know:

  • What equipment you have

  • When each item was last examined

  • When the next examination is due

  • What defects have been identified

  • Whether corrective actions have been completed


10. Overdue LOLER Thorough Examinations

One of the simplest problems to prevent is allowing an examination to become overdue.

For equipment subject to the standard LOLER intervals, Thorough Examinations are generally required:

Every 6 months for:

  • Lifting accessories

  • Equipment used for lifting people

Every 12 months for:

  • Other lifting equipment used for lifting loads

However, a competent person can establish different examination intervals through a suitable examination scheme where appropriate. Additional examinations may also be required following certain events or changes affecting the equipment.

How to reduce the risk

Don't wait until the certificate is about to expire.

Maintain an equipment register and schedule your next examination in advance.


What Should You Do If Your Equipment Has a LOLER Defect?

If a Thorough Examination identifies a defect, the action required depends on its nature and severity.

Where a defect is considered to be, or could become, a danger to people, the dutyholder should be informed immediately and effective action taken to prevent the equipment being used until the defect has been remedied.

This is why it is important to take inspection findings seriously.

A LOLER report isn't simply a certificate to file away — it provides important information about the condition and safety of your lifting equipment.


How Can You Reduce LOLER Failures?

The best way to reduce the likelihood of defects is to take a proactive approach to lifting equipment safety.

1. Carry Out Pre-Use Checks

Operators should carry out appropriate checks before using lifting equipment.

2. Maintain Equipment Properly

Follow manufacturer recommendations and address defects promptly.

3. Train Your Employees

Make sure people using lifting equipment understand how to operate it safely and identify obvious defects.

4. Keep Accurate Records

Maintain your LOLER reports, maintenance records and equipment register.

5. Schedule Thorough Examinations on Time

Don't wait until an examination is overdue.

6. Use a Competent Inspection Company

Your Thorough Examination needs to be carried out by a competent person with suitable knowledge and experience of the equipment being examined.

Frequently Asked Questions About LOLER Failures


What is the most common LOLER failure?

There isn't one single defect that applies to every type of lifting equipment. Common issues can include wear, damage, corrosion, defective safety components, damaged lifting accessories and inadequate identification or records.


What happens if lifting equipment fails a LOLER inspection?

The competent person will report the defect and specify the action required. Where a defect is, or could become, dangerous to people, the equipment should not be used until the defect has been appropriately addressed.


How often does lifting equipment need a LOLER inspection?

The standard intervals are generally six months for lifting accessories and equipment used to lift people, and 12 months for other lifting equipment, unless a competent person's examination scheme specifies different intervals.


Does LOLER inspection replace maintenance?

No. A Thorough Examination and routine maintenance are separate requirements. Lifting equipment must continue to be maintained so that it remains safe to use.


Who can carry out a LOLER Thorough Examination?

It must be carried out by a competent person with appropriate practical and theoretical knowledge and experience of the lifting equipment being examined. HSE guidance also emphasises the importance of sufficient independence and impartiality.
